Choosing an audio format
| Format | Compatibility | Quality | File size |
|---|---|---|---|
| MP3 | Universal—phones, cars, old players | Good at 192 kbps | Smallest |
| M4A (AAC) | Apple ecosystem, modern Android | Slightly better per MB | Small |
| WAV | Editors, archival | Lossless container, lossy source | Largest |
For 95% of "download youtube audio" jobs, MP3 at 192 kbps is the answer. Pick 128 kbps when it's an hour-long talk and every megabyte counts on mobile data.
Example: a 45-minute lecture at 128 kbps is roughly 42 MB. Same lecture as 720p video could exceed 600 MB.

YouTube Premium: does it download audio?
Premium downloads the whole video for offline playback inside the YouTube app. There's no separate "audio only" offline mode. You still can't export that audio to Audacity or your car's USB stick as MP3. For a portable audio file, converters win over Premium.
Premium makes sense when you want offline replay with video in the official app—not when you need a soundtrack file.
When YouTube audio won't download
- No audio track — Rare, but some uploads are silent placeholders.
- Blocked music content — Label restrictions on official releases.
- Age-gated videos — Converters often can't authenticate.
- Members-only / rentals — DRM.
- Active live stream — Wait for the VOD replay.
Retry with a different upload of the same material (artist channel vs topic channel). If two public versions fail, the rights holder is probably blocking extraction.
